Remove the parameters Carpet::prolongate_initial_data; this is now always done. Remove arguments initialise_from and do_prolongate from Regrid(). Regridding is now done in level mode instead of meta mode. Furthermore, CarpetRegrid is called in singlemape mode. darcs-hash:20040418112943-07bb3-2e392df1737ab75f3f0d553bb53bde2ed41f8773.gz
